I would say the Fuji X-Pro2 & X-T2, Sony A7 series, and Olympus OM-D E-M1 Mk2 aren't necessarily big, but they are at the larger size end of their respective model lines. And, if you add fast glass, especially for FF like the A7 series, then the size could ramp up quite fast. With Fuji, you have the X-E2(S) and X-T10 if you wanted to go smaller, they're no slouch for speed, but the fastest and more accurate AF including generally faster operation of the camera you will find with the lastest X-Pro2 & X-T2 for now. The Fuji X70 with the wide angle converter would give you a nice compact 24mm (equiv.) focal length. Sony A7, you probably will want to go with the Mk2 versions of any of them because of the better AF and IBIS.. and they're generally faster than the first gen and not as loud. I would say you could possibly get away with using the Sony RX100 Mk4 for smallest pocketable camera from Sony. The A6300 is smaller, but the APS-C line of glass kind of sucks. Fast glass for FF on even the A7's can be quite large.. they could be as larger, if not larger, than the camera body itself. If you still have some rangefinder glass from your Leica and Voigtlander film cameras, they could be adapted and keep system as small as possible, but they would only be manual focusing. The OM-D E-M1 Mk2 is going to be nice, but it won't be out till probably early next year at the earliest. If you don't need all the fancy features the E-M1 Mk2 offers, the OM-D E-M5 Mk2 or E-M10 Mk2 could work just as well and be as small as possible. I fancy the Pen-F myself. And, you have nice 24mm (equiv.) options such as the Olympus 12mm f/2 and the new Panasonic-Leica 12mm F/1.4 Summilux. The new Canon EOS M5 looks promising as far as new Canon mirrorless is concerned.. you could use your existing Canon glass as well with an adapater, or get a native mount lens(es) for the M5. If you're really interested in M43 and want to consider video a bonus, currently, you're best served staying with a Panasonic. Practically all of them offer 4k video and their IQ and performance is about as good as Olympus, if not better for video in particular. Anything within at least the last year or two, you will have no issues with having wifi to connect to your phone, so that particular aspect should be the least of your concerns, it will be on all cameras.
